WebPraise achievement and effort Focus your praise on effort and hard work, rather than just the end product. For instance, after a soccer game, praise your child for winning the game and trying her hardest. Praise with your words and body Adding smiles, a rub on the back, enthusiasm, a hug, a kiss or a high five can make praise feel extra special. WebGender differences also occur in the realm of classroom behavior. Teachers tend to praise girls for “good” behavior, regardless of its relevance to content or to the lesson at hand, and tend to criticize boys for “bad” or inappropriate behavior (Golombok & Fivush, 1994).
